Output 41ec16d5bf4deae3ca7dc057670d5a60341ffe569dbebb70646778e5a6a3c5c4:1

value
850541473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8895ead59c33e3665a3935bbe166090ff6a0846 OP_EQUAL
address
3QMA4jvy34noXVzfAodR62ADDmxnEGNzjR
transaction
41ec16d5bf4deae3ca7dc057670d5a60341ffe569dbebb70646778e5a6a3c5c4
spent
true